Introducing Emulate3D Factory Test
Enterprise-scale digital twins unlock new possibilities for virtual controls testing

Emulate3D® Factory Test™ demonstrates how the solution enables factory-scale virtual controls testing, helping manufacturers conduct Factory Acceptance Testing to validate automation systems before deployment. Emulate3D Factory Test is integrated with NVIDIA Omniverse™ APIs and OpenUSD, redefining digital twin technology with high-fidelity simulation and real-time collaboration.

Emulate3D Factory Test key capabilities include:

  • Multi-model orchestration. Synchronizing multiple system models for factory-scale testing.
  • Modern DevOps workflows. Streamlining version control, testing and deployment while allowing all stakeholders to work from the latest version, track changes in real time and maintain alignment across teams.
  • Test Runner. Enabling repeatable, automated testing at scale.
  • Fault Framework. Simulating fault conditions to assess system resilience.
  • Advanced full-factory visualization. Powered by NVIDIA Omniverse APIs, initially available via private preview.
